A chalazion begins gradually as a small, red bump on your eyelid that may be painful. The condition isn’t an infection, however. After a few days, the pain usually subsides, but the cyst keeps growing. It can reach the size of a pea. While a chalazion tends to form on your upper eyelid, one may appear on the lower one, as well. Although chalazia, occur most often in adults between the ages of 30 to 50, they do occasionally appear in children. Chalazion excision procedure begins by administering a local anesthetic to numb the area around the cyst. The doctor then places a clamp on your eyelid to hold it still during the chalazion excision procedure. After making a tiny incision at the chalazion, the eye doctor uses a specialized instrument to remove the cyst.
